Credit lines
While business owners have used lines of credit for a number of years, consumers have been less acquainted with this kind of financing. These loans are not often advertised by banks due to the fact that they aren't as well-known. However, you can obtain a home equity loan. As the name suggests, this type of financing is secured by the borrower's home, but it comes with the risk of its own.
There are two types of credit for business. A credit line that is revolving is one that you can use to make purchases. A nonrevolving credit line is one you pay off after you have used it. Both types of financing for businesses have pros and drawbacks. Revolving lines of credit are often the best choice for ongoing expenses while a non-revolving credit line may be more suitable for starting a new business.
When you are applying for a business line of credit, keep in mind that they often come with variable interest rates as well as fees. The rates will likely increase over time and the costs can quickly mount up. One disadvantage of business lines of credit is the issues in obtaining these. A lot of lenders limit the amount of credit you can use, so if you do not have a significant amount of capital, you might not be able to qualify for a line of credit.
It is crucial to consider the way you intend to use the money when deciding on a line of credit for your business. While you may need an account immediately, your business might not be in dire need of it for a few months or even years. Small businesses can use this type of finance to pay for expenses for payroll, purchase new inventory, or Company Funding options to deal with temporary financial difficulties. It is not recommended for long-term business demands, but it can be a useful tool.
Lines of Credit could be the ideal solution for the seasonal fluctuations that occur in your business. If your customers take a few weeks or even months to pay for your goods or services, a line of credit is the only way to ensure a steady flow of money. You can also make use of your credit line to pay for expenses, like production costs, and purchasing discounted inventory. This could be the moment to find the money you need to expand your business.
